Customer Review: Good value and durable Summary: 4 Stars
I've owned this set for three years, and love the quality and durability. They heat evenly, and the nonstick surface is excellent. If you buy this set, DO NOT put any items in the dishwasher (including the lids); the detergent and environment is simply too harsh for them. I have always hand washed mine, and all the pieces still look brand new. This is a great value, and should last for a long time if taken care of.
Customer Review: Basic Cooking not for Entertaining Summary: 3 Stars
My sister and I purchased this product as a gift for our mother. She loves the non-stick surfaces and the ability to store the lids in limited spaces, however I think she was disappointed with the size of the pots and frying pan. Very small compared to her older cookware. Was not anxious to get rid of her old oversized cookware as she often entertains a large family. Is perfect for family of two.
